The highly anticipated fourth edition of Exploring Innovation expands on the wide-ranging and varied scope of innovation found in earlier editions. The text explores the diverse and varied forms that innovation can take to demonstrate that the process of innovation is about much more than inventing and managing new products. Written in an accessible style, Exploring Innovation encourages students to delve into a range of recent developments in innovation including frugal and social innovation. Extensive use of case studies provides plenty of practical examples that bring key concepts to life.
The new edition features:
•Two brand new chapters on Frugal Innovation – doing more with less, and Social Innovation - meeting social needs
•Coverage of recent developments in green innovation with four new mini-cases covering sustainability issues such as the circular economy and community energy
•A new focus on the application of innovation
•12 new case studies including: Eco Wave Power, Brompton Folding Bicycle, Doc Martens, Evolution of the EV, Northvolt and Grameen Bank, along with many new mini-cases throughout
David Smith is Emeritus Professor of Innovation Management at Nottingham Business School, Nottingham Trent University.
